SB 5983 - 2023-24
Revised for 1st Substitute: Implementing recommendations from the 2022 sexually transmitted infection and hepatitis B virus legislative advisory group for the treatment of syphilis.
Original: Allowing medical assistants with telehealth supervision to provide intramuscular injections for syphilis treatment.
